    Hello everyone,

    I'm using a plugin on my site that doesn't register the (primary) sidebar in single posts, which I'm using for a widget to show the submenu. However, the BLOG posts are also single posts, and they do register the sidebar! What's happening here?

    The author of the plugin wrote that I should check the single.php file and make sure that the sidebar code is present. Single.php is not a file where I can find any code, in Genesis... He also wrote that I need to add a case for is_singular( 'job_listing' ) if the output for sidebars is conditional. (Which I guess is the case... How else could the sidebar be displayed in single posts from the blog?)

    Unfortunately, I still don't know what to do with this answer. For me it doesn't rhyme with the way Genesis is coded. Having said that, I'm also someone who's not exactly familiar with PHP yet. I really hope I can solve this issue.

    Problem is in your plugin. It is not Genesis Issue. when I am visiting Opportunities page then I am getting sidebar content and showing child page links. Because plugin is getting the parent page ID and fetching the sub pages successfully.

    But when you'll show the single job listing page, thattime plugin is not getting the ID of Opportunities page and plugin is not returning any result. So please send a mail to plugin's developer and discuss about it.
